      Okay so basically after shuffle 1 add an extend chop. Then youll want to connect another shuffle chop, but this time in its parameters under method select 'split N Samples' and take your led strip quantity for example, 300 pixel strip multiply by 3 so N Value = 900, enter 900 then connect another shuffle Split N Samples again but now you can choose 512 (but youll want 510 beacuse if its not a clean division number itll cause the light strip to invert the colors at the 150th pixel, you can tweak it for a longer pixel count) so 510 for the second shuffle N value. then add a math range 0-255, you can rename chop if you want, then null :)
